National Women’s Commission to investigate Ruchika case

New Delhi, Dec 23 (ANI) : The National Commission for Women on Wednesday decided to form committee to examine Ruchika Girhotra case.

The committee comprising of advocates will examine the sequence of events since the complaint was first filed against former Haryana DGP SPS Rathore.

According to NCW the committee would also investigate whether there was any attempt to hush up the matter.

The NCW will ask the committee to submit a report within two months.

A 14-year-old Ruchika killed herself sixteen years ago.

The then DGP Rathore who was accused of molesting Ruchika managed to escape with a paltry fine and a mere sentence of six months imprisonment for which bail has already been granted.

The civil rights organisations are demanding to charge Rathore with abetting suicide. (ANI)
